«

»

Mar 29 2012

OpenJournal Kurulumu

OpenJournal(1) ilk kurulduğunda, boş sayfa hatası gelebiliyor. Apache'nin error.log dosyasına bakılırsa, klasör izinlerinde dorun olduğu anlaşılabiliyor.

Sistemin dili Türkçe'ye çevrildiğinde de aşağıdaki hatayı veriyor:
Fatal error: Call to undefined method DBConnection::getInstance() in /usr/share/openjournal/lib/pkp/classes/db/DBConnection.inc.php on line 232

Bu durumda da, şunu yapmak gerekiyor(2):

/usr/share/openjournal/lib/pkp/classes/i18n/PKPLocale.inc.php dosyasının 108. satırında başlayan şu kısım silinmeli:

 if (!@setlocale(LC_ALL, $sysLocale, $locale)) {
         // For PHP < 4.3.0
         if(setlocale(LC_ALL, $sysLocale) != $sysLocale) {
                 setlocale(LC_ALL, $locale);
         }
 }

 

(1) OJS 2.3.7 Release Notes
 
GIT tag: ojs-2_3_7-0
  Release date: March 16, 2012

(2) http://sonmezcelik.blogspot.com/2012/03/ojs-236-surumu-turkce-dil-hatas.html

  1. ali

    Murat bey çok faydalı oldu, teşekkürler…

  2. vedat elçigil

    Teşekkürler arkadaşım,,

Bir Cevap Yazın

Bad Behavior has blocked 23 access attempts in the last 7 days.